Compact Key for Schools Student's Book without answers with Digital Pack English for Spanish Speakers

By (author) Emma Heyderman, By (author) Susan White





This book is currently unavailable. Enquire to check if we can source a used copy


| book description |

Fast, focused exam preparation - a 50 to 60 hour course for the A2 Key for Schools exam from 2020. Compact helps you build confidence with its unique step-by-step approach and teaches essential exam strategies through user-friendly exam tips. This Student's Book without answers includes 12 units of targeted exam practice, Revision pages and exam-specific Grammar sections, a Grammar reference, a Speaking bank and a Writing bank and a dedicated English for Spanish Speakers practice section with advice on problematic spelling, listening activities, examples of grammatical mistakes and how to correct them, and commonly used words and expressions. It also includes an access code to Cambridge One for additional resources to build exam strategies and skills.
